How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 66030?

66030 apartments
Bed Type Average Rent Range
1BR $1,400 $1,220 - $1,550
2BR $1,630 $1,330 - $1,790
3BR $2,790 $1,700 - $2,790
4+BR $2,270 $2,150 - $2,400

Methodology

Each month, using over 1 million Rentable listings across the United States, we calculate the median 1-bedroom and 2-bedroom rent prices by city, state, and nation, and track the month-over-month percent change. To avoid small sample sizes, we restrict the analysis for our reports to cities meeting minimum population and property count thresholds.
